Job Description
Summary
This position requires a certified highly specialized technician who performs a variety of complex skills and functions in the preparation of hazardous and non-hazardous sterile medications. Provides high quality patient centered care utilizing technician knowledge to ensure safe effective and efficient medication therapy.
Learn more about this agency
Duties
The duties related to this position include but are not limited to the following:
Demonstrates in-depth knowledge of sterile product preparation and shortage. Able to work independently to compound complex hazardous as well as other high-risk medications.
Communicates on a regular basis with the oncology pharmacists and at times nurses in the clinic to reduce medication waste.
Assists with training pharmacy staff and students with aseptic technique, dispensing all hazardous and non-hazardous sterile products.
Independently selects the proper additive and diluent solution to prepare a final product as ordered.
Incorporates understanding of mathematical calculations required to add the correct volume of medication.
Has oncology pharmacy complete check of prepared sterile product prior to patient infusion for accuracy.
Maintains current knowledge of USP 797/800 and ensures compliance with all VA policies and procedures, Joint Commission that relate to sterile medication preparation.
Maintain the compounding sterile area equipment are cleaned and maintained in good operation. Records refrigerator temperatures, humidity, air pressures and temperature daily. Ensures required cleaning of each sterile area is completed on a daily/ monthly basis as required by VA policy and procedure. .
Maintain inventory and rotation of all stocked items in the oncology pharmacy on a monthly basis to ensure decrease waste (cost containment).

Basic Requirements:
Basic Requirements:
A. Citizenship: Be a citizen of the United States. Non-citizens may be appointed when it is not possible to recruit qualified citizens in accordance with 38 U.S.C. § 7407(a).
B. English Proficiency: Pharmacy Technician candidates must be proficient in spoken and written English to be appointed as authorized by 38 U.S.C. § 7403(f).
C. Certification: For positions above the full performance level, the employee must pass a national certification exam and hold an active national certification through either:
Pharmacy Technician Certification Board (PTCB), Certified Pharmacy Technician (CPhT). OR
National Healthcareer Association (NHA), Certified Pharmacy Technician (ExCPT).
D. Grandfathering Provision: may qualify based on being covered by the Grandfathering Provision as described in the VA Qualification Standard for this occupation (only applicable to current VHA employees who are in this occupation and meet the criteria.
Grade Determinations: In addition to the basic requirements above, applicants must meet the following grade requirements.
Experience Requirement. Candidates must possess one year of experience equivalent to the next lower grade level of GS-7.
May qualify based on being covered by the Grandfathering Provision as described in the VA Qualification Standard for this occupation (only applicable to current VHA employees who are in this occupation and meet the criteria).
Creditable Experience. To be creditable, a candidate must possess the required knowledge, skills and abilities (KSAs) associated with the scope of pharmacy technician practice. The candidate's experience must be evidenced by active professional practice. (Active professional practice means paid/nonpaid employment as a professional pharmacy technician.)
Part-Time Experience. Part-time experience is creditable according to its relationship to the full-time work week. For example, one week of full-time credit is equivalent to two weeks of half-time work.
Quality of Experience. Qualifying experience must be at a level comparable to pharmacy technician experience at the next lower grade level. For all assignments above the full performance level, the higher-level duties must consist of significant scope, administrative independence, complexity and range of variety as described in this standard at the specified grade level and be performed by the incumbent at least 25% of the time.
Required Knowledge, Skills and Abilities (KSAs): In addition to the experience above, the candidate must demonstrate the following KSAs for all GS-08 assignments and meet any additional KSAs for the assignment, if indicated:
Comprehensive knowledge of concepts, principles, methodology and policies in a specialized area or section of pharmacy (such as sterile compounding, controlled substances, automation, clinical pharmacy, contact center, etc.) Note: See Specialized Area.in the Definitions Section.
Skill in training and orienting new and existing pharmacy facility employees and students on proper policies and procedures.
Ability to evaluate, analyze and coordinate workflow and work activities within a specialized area or section of the pharmacy.
